The Importance of a Key Fob
The key fob is an integral part of modern lorries. It serves various purposes consisting of:
- Remote locking and opening: Allows you to lock or open your car from a distance.
- Engine begin: Many BMW Spare Key models feature push-to-start technology, which needs the key fob to be present.
- Security system gain access to: The key fob is linked to the car’s security functions, guaranteeing that unauthorized workers can not access or begin the car.
- Convenience features: Some BMW fobs include functions like remote start and trunk release.
Provided their multifunctionality, losing a key fob can lead to problems beyond simple inconvenience.
Kinds Of BMW Key Fobs
Before diving into the replacement procedure, it is necessary to understand the kinds of key fobs readily available for BMW cars:
| Model Year | Kind Of Key Fob | Functions |
|---|---|---|
| Pre-2000 | Conventional key | Manual locking/unlocking |
| 2000-2010 | Basic remote fob | Remote locking/unlocking, transponder |
| 2011-Present | Smart key fob | Proximity sensors, push-to-start, comfort gain access to |
How to Replace Your BMW Key Fob
Step-by-Step Process
-
Assess the Situation: Determine if the key fob is Lost BMW Key or broken. If it’s broken, examine whether it’s repairable.
-
Collect Required Information: Have your Vehicle Identification Number (VIN), evidence of ownership, and identification at hand.
-
Visit the Dealership or Authorized Service Center: For the majority of designs, the best choice is to go to a BMW car dealership or licensed service center. The personnel can help configure a new key fob.
-
Pick the Replacement Option:
- Original O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er): Preferred for their dependability, though usually more pricey.
- Aftermarket Options: These can be less costly however may do not have the quality and functions of the OEM alternatives.
-
Budget for the Costs: Replacing a BMW key fob can be costly. Expect to spend for both the fob and programs.
Expenses Overview
| Product | Average Cost (GBP) |
|---|---|
| OEM Key Fob | ₤ 300 – ₤ 600 |
| Aftermarket Key Fob | ₤ 100 – ₤ 300 |
| Programming Fees | ₤ 50 – ₤ 150 |
Self-Programming (Limited Models)
In some cases, BMW Key Fob Replacement owners can configure a new key fob themselves. This is hardly ever appropriate to contemporary models, however it can prosper on older cars. The self-programming process typically involves:
- Inserting an existing key into the ignition.
- Turning the ignition on and off repeatedly.
- Following specific sequences that might vary by design.
Keep in mind: Always describe the owner’s handbook for model-specific instructions.
Frequently Asked Questions about BMW Key Fob Replacement
1. For how long does it require to get a replacement key fob?
The time can vary depending upon the dealership’s stock and programming requirements. Normally, it takes anywhere from 1 to 3 hours.
2. Can I utilize an aftermarket key fob?
Yes, however compatibility and performance may be limited. It is suggested to use OEM parts to make sure optimal efficiency.
3. Is there a warranty on a New Key For BMW key fob?
A lot of dealers offer a warranty on the key fob and its shows, but it may vary by dealership.
4. Can I have a spare key fob configured?
Yes, having a spare key fob is constantly an excellent idea for benefit and security.
5. What do I do if my key fob quits working?
Inspect the battery, and if replacing it doesn’t solve the issue, consult your BMW dealership or an authorized service center for more support.
